Qubad Talabani: PUK Will Continue to Defend Rights of Our People with Greater Determination

Qubad Talabani, supervisor of the electoral campaign of the List 222 of the Patriotic Union of Kurdistan (PUK) in Erbil, met the families of the martyrs and reaffirmed that the PUK will continue to defend the rights of the people with greater determination than ever before.
Talabani said in post on his Facebook page: "I stood with the proud crowns of the PUK and the symbols of endurance and resistance. The parents, sons, daughters, brothers and sisters of our noble martyrs."
"The Patriotic Union of Kurdistan draws its strength and courage from your unwavering resolve and will continue to defend the rights of our people with greater determination than ever before," he added. "Rest assured, this enduring PUK will keep the sacred path our martyrs bright by serving you and defending the right of our people."
The PUK is contesting the 2025 Iraqi parliamentary elections, scheduled for 11 November, across several governorates, presenting its candidates on an independent list numbered 222 in Erbil, Sulaymaniyah (including Halabja), Duhok, Kirkuk, and Diyala. In Nineveh Governorate, the PUK is running as part of the "Nineveh People’s Union Coalition" with list number 281, while in Saladin it is fielding one candidate within the "National Masses Coalition" with list number 240.
Overall, the PUK is entering the elections with 156 candidates: 36 in Sulaymaniyah, 30 in Erbil, 5 in Duhok, 24 in Kirkuk, 28 in Diyala, 31 in Nineveh within the Nineveh People’s Union coalition, and one candidate each in Saladin and Baghdad.
